Most devices labeled "USB 2.0 Ser" are actually . These are chips that allow legacy devices (like older printers, CNC machines, networking switches, and microcontrollers) to communicate with modern computers via a USB port. The Usual Suspect: The CH340 Chip In 90% of cases where you see the "USB 2.0 Ser" label, the hardware is utilizing a chip manufactured by Jiangsu QinHeng Electronics Co., Ltd. , commonly known by their chip model number: CH340 .
